Greeley, CO vs Morristown, TN
Cost of Living Comparison
Morristown, TN is more affordable by 13.8 index points
Side-by-Side Comparison
| Category | Greeley, CO | Morristown, TN |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Overall | 100.2 | 86.4 | +13.8 |
| Housing | 112.6 | 59.0 | +53.6 |
| Goods | 96.1 | 96.2 | -0.2 |
| Utilities | 82.0 | 72.4 | +9.6 |
| Other Services | 99.8 | 95.1 | +4.7 |
Income & Housing Comparison
| Metric | Greeley, CO | Morristown, TN |
|---|---|---|
| Median Household Income | $89,182 | $52,913 |
| Median Home Value | $412,200 | $170,100 |
| Median Monthly Rent | $1,351 | $803 |
| Per Capita Income | $39,480 | $29,207 |
